Pomegranate and Grape Information

Color of a fruit helps in determining its nutrient content and hence, its nutritional value. Therefore, color can considered as an important factor of Pomegranate and Grape Information. Pomegranate is found in shades of dark red and light pink-red and Grape is found in shades of green and red. Get Pomegranate vs Grape characteristics comparison of the basis of properties like their taste, texture, color, size, seasonal availability and much more! Pomegranate belongs to Tree Fruit category whereas Grape belongs to Berry category. Pomegranate originated in India and Iran while Grape originated in Western Asia and Central Europe.

Pomegranate and Grape Varieties

Pomegranate and Grape varieties form an important part of Pomegranate vs Grape characteristics. Due to advancements and development in the field of horticulture science, it is possible to get many varieties of Pomegranate and Grape. The varieties of Pomegranate are Balegal, Crab, Cloud, Francis, Freshman and Granada whereas the varieties of Grape are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, Pinot Noir, Syrah/Shiraz and Zinfandel. The shape of Pomegranate and Grape is Round and Oval respecitely. Talking about the taste, Pomegranate is juicy and sweet in taste and Grape is sweet-sour.
